6 Common Mistakes That Lead to Costly Heating Repairs

6 Common Mistakes That Lead to Costly Heating Repairs

None of us enjoy making mistakes, especially when it comes to an expensive part of our home like the HVAC system. Unfortunately, homeowners are making simple mistakes with their HVAC system without even knowing it! Some of these will cost you time, some will cost you money and eventually, some will cost you both. 

The cost of repairs to your heating and cooling system can vary greatly, depending on the extent of the issue. However, many of these repairs can be prevented with routine HVAC maintenance and prompt attention to any suspected problems. Don’t ignore your HVAC system…PREVENT the possibility of a costly repair by avoiding these costly mistakes:

1. Forgetting/Ignoring Maintenance:

As simple as it may sound, forgetting or ignoring preventive HVAC maintenance is one of the most common heating mistakes that can cost you. This mistake can negatively affect the efficiency and power of your HVAC system. It’s advisable to have an HVAC professional conduct preventive maintenance in the Spring for your AC and during Fall for your heating. Not only will this prepare your system for the upcoming hot and cold seasons but any potential issues can be remedied early. Having a preventative HVAC Maintenance Service Contract helps eliminate the worry.

2. Ignoring Early Repair Signs: 

An HVAC system usually gives warning signs before breaking down. However, some people ignore, or don’t know, these early signs and end up paying a lot more for an extensive repair. Some common signs of an HVAC problem include weak airflow, cold spots in the house, short cycling, strange noises or smells, and high heating or cooling bills. 3. Cranking Up Your Thermostat:

If you think the solution to eliminating cold in your home is by turning the thermostat reading way up, then you’re wrong. Running your heating system at its greatest capacity will lower its efficiency and lifespan. This is because setting your thermostat reading higher causes your system to run longer and harder. We recommend keeping your thermostat between 68 and 72 degrees, turning it up higher during the Summer and lower during the Winter. Or, simply get a programmable thermostat and set your minimum and maximum temperatures for optimal time windows.

4. Forgetting To Regularly Change Air Filters:

Air filters keep the air flowing into your home clean and free of contaminants. Dust, dirt, and other particles are kept out of your home when you have clean air filters, which improves the air quality of your home and makes your HVAC system run more efficiently. Over time, air filters will become clogged with dust, reducing air flow. In order to maintain optimum air flow efficiency, we recommend changing your air filters once a month during the months you use your heating and cooling system the most and once every three months during the months of less frequent HVAC usage.

5. Undertaking DIY Heating Repairs: 

While DIY enthusiasts may have good intentions, some tasks are best left to the professionals. HVAC repair is one of these tasks. HVAC systems operate on gas and electricity, so there is a high safety risk when attempting to repair a furnace or air conditioning system on your own. In addition, a DIYer lacks the skills, expertise, specialized tools and licenses to properly fix HVAC issues and most likely will void the system warranty.

6. Hiring an Unlicensed HVAC Contractor:

A common mistake people make when it comes to an HVAC repair is hiring an unlicensed contractor to save money. This can result in recurrent problems, worsening of the existing issue, and voiding your HVAC equipment warranties. Hiring an unlicensed and uninsured HVAC contractor can also put you at risk of liability for any injuries sustained by a workman on your property. Always ensure your HVAC contractor is licensed AND insured!
